A less established college in the world, Gaureshwar Naraian Singh Teachers Training College, Nabinagar, Bihar's premier teachers' training institution, Gaureshwar Naraian Singh Teachers Training College, Nabinagar, is sponsored by two full-time courses, Bachelor of Education (B.Ed.) and Diploma in Elementary Education (D.El.Ed), both of which are two years long. This institution is affiliated with the National Council for Teacher Education, New Delhi, which ensures quality education for prospective teachers.
Generally, the admission procedure for Gaureshwar Naraian Singh Teachers Training College is set following the policies of the state government and the related university. Merit is the basis of the selection process, taking into account the qualifying and/or entrance examinations on the marks earned. A selective admission procedure ensures that the best aspirants are selected for the programmes and are prepared to make the next move into an effective learning structure for the future. The B.Ed course in Gaureshwar Naraian Singh Teachers Training College has an authorised intake of 100 students. Gaureshwar Naraian Singh Teachers Training College admission in the course is based purely on merit, which comprises of marks obtained in the qualifying examination and/or entrance examination. The process of selection may include such additional criteria as may be determined by the policy of the state government/U.T. Administration and the university. Candidates should have done graduation or post-graduation on any course from a recognised university to be eligible for Gaureshwar Naraian Singh Teachers Training College admission to the B.Ed programme.
100 students are also provided with the intake at the D.El.Ed programme. The pattern for Gaureshwar Naraian Singh Teachers Training College admission of D.El.Ed is similar to that of B.Ed course. Selection for entry into the D.El.Ed programme is also by merit. Candidates are ranked according to performance in the qualifying examination and/or through an entrance examination. Gaureshwar Naraian Singh Teachers Training College admission follows the regulations of the state government/UT Administration. For all intents and purposes, D.El.Ed eligibility requires 10+2 or equivalent examinations through a recognised board.
